Lead Cast: Kritika Sachdeva, Indraneil Sengupta, Sasho Satiiysh Saarathy, and Sanghmitra Hitaishi. The Plot: What's It About?
Unlike the first film, B.A. Pass 2 is a standalone story rather than a direct sequel. It follows Neha, a young woman from Bhopal who moves to Mumbai to escape an arranged marriage. Seeking independence, she finds herself making a series of desperate choices and adopting dangerous habits that lead her down a dark, ruinous path.

Entertainment industry view: This is not competition; it is theft. Filmyzilla costs the Indian film industry an estimated ₹20,000 crore annually in lost revenue.
User lifestyle view: This is a library of Alexandria for poor cinephiles. A student in a small town cannot afford a multiplex ticket or a premium OTT plan. For them, Filmyzilla is the only cinema.
Theatrical windows have shrunk. But for a movie like B.a P 2, the gap between cinema release and OTT (Over-The-Top) debut can still be 4-8 weeks. Filmyzilla exploits that gap. The modern lifestyle is allergic to waiting. If a colleague has already watched a pirated copy over the weekend, social pressure drives the search.
People don't just watch movies; they multitask. While cooking, driving, or working. Piracy sites offer low-resolution, compressed files that are easier to download and store on a phone. Legal streamers use high-bitrate 4K files that eat storage. Hence, B.a P 2 movie download (a small 300MB file) fits the mobile-first lifestyle better than a 5GB legal stream.

Predicting the end of piracy is naive. But the lifestyle is shifting. Younger audiences (Gen Alpha) are growing up with cheap, legal, ad-supported streaming (AVOD). They find piracy websites "sketchy" and "annoying."
Moreover, the rise of blockchain-based distribution and NFT movie tickets might create a secondary market for cheap, legal downloads. If a studio sells B.a P 2 for $1 directly to fans, Filmyzilla loses its biggest advantage: price.
